什么是服务器端口验证

不及物动词 其他 12

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器端口验证是一种安全机制,用于验证与服务器之间的数据通信是否合法。在计算机网络中,服务器(Server)通过端口(Port)与其他设备或应用程序进行通信。端口是一个数字,用于识别应用程序或服务,类似于房子的门牌号码。

    服务器端口验证是确保通信的双方实际上是合法的服务器和客户端之间建立可信连接的过程。它通过检查进入服务器的数据流是否符合预设的规则来验证连接的有效性。这些规则可以包括端口号的范围、传输协议的类型和访问控制列表等。

    服务器端口验证主要用于以下几个方面:

    1. 安全性保护:通过对服务器进行端口验证,可以防止未经授权的访问,保护服务器免受恶意攻击、入侵和数据泄露的威胁。

    2. 访问控制:服务器端口验证可以让服务器管理员根据需要对不同端口进行权限控制,限制特定端口的访问范围,只允许授权的应用程序或设备进行通信。

    3. 防火墙管理:服务器端口验证也可以与防火墙技术结合使用,通过设置规则来控制网络流量的进出。只有通过验证的端口才能通过防火墙,提高网络安全性。

    4. 服务识别:通过服务器端口验证,可以识别连接到服务器的应用程序或服务类型。这有助于服务器管理员了解网络中正在运行的应用程序,并及时采取相应的维护措施。

    服务器端口验证通常在服务器操作系统或防火墙上进行配置。具体的配置方法和验证规则会因不同的系统和软件而有所不同。然而,无论采用何种方式进行服务器端口验证,其基本目的都是确保网络通信的合法性和安全性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器端口验证是一种用于确保网络上的服务器和服务端口的安全性的技术。它是通过验证发出连接请求的客户端的来源和目的地的有效性来实现的。在服务器端口验证中,服务器会对连接请求的客户端进行身份验证和权限验证,以确保只有合法的客户端能够通过验证并与服务器进行通信。

    下面是关于服务器端口验证的五个重要点:

    1. 身份验证:服务器端口验证通常涉及身份验证过程,以确认连接请求是来自合法的客户端。这可以通过不同的方式实现,常用的身份验证方法包括用户名和密码、数字证书、IP地址过滤等。只有通过合法身份验证的连接请求才能成功连接服务器。

    2. 权限验证:服务器端口验证还可以用于对连接请求的客户端进行权限验证。权限验证是服务器对连接请求的客户端进行验证,以确定其是否具有访问所请求的服务端口的权限。这可以通过检查客户端的用户权限、角色权限或其他授权机制来实现。

    3. 安全性增强:服务器端口验证可以增强服务器的安全性,防止未经授权的访问和恶意攻击。通过身份验证和权限验证,服务器可以确保只有合法用户能够连接和访问服务端口,从而防止黑客和未经授权的用户获取敏感信息或执行恶意操作。

    4. 防止端口滥用:服务器端口验证还可以防止客户端滥用服务器的端口资源。服务器通过验证客户端的身份和权限,可以限制具有相应权限的客户端可以访问的服务端口范围。这可以确保服务器的端口资源只被授权用户使用,防止滥用和资源浪费。

    5. 日志记录和审计:服务器端口验证还可以用于日志记录和审计目的。通过在验证过程中记录连接请求、身份验证信息和权限验证结果等数据,管理员可以追踪和分析网络活动,识别潜在的安全问题和风险,并采取相应的措施进行防范和改进。

    总之,服务器端口验证是一项重要的安全措施,可以确保只有合法用户能够连接和访问服务器的服务端口,并防止未经授权的访问和恶意攻击。通过身份验证和权限验证,服务器可以提高安全性,防止端口滥用,并提供日志记录和审计功能。这对于保护服务器和网络的安全至关重要。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器端口验证是一种网络安全机制,用于验证服务器上的端口是否打开、可用和安全。它是保护服务器免受恶意攻击和未授权访问的重要方法之一。服务器端口验证使用的是一种被称为端口扫描的技术,通过扫描服务器上的端口,判断端口是否被打开、监听和响应。

    服务器上的每个服务都会使用一个或多个特定的端口来接收网络数据。例如,HTTP服务使用80号端口,HTTPS服务使用443号端口。端口验证的主要目的是确定这些服务所使用的端口是否开放和可用。攻击者常常通过扫描服务器的端口来查找易受攻击的服务和漏洞,并利用它们进行攻击。

    服务器端口验证的操作流程如下:

    1. 选择合适的端口验证工具:市面上有许多端口验证工具,例如Nmap、Wireshark等。选择适合自己的工具。
    2. 设置验证目标:输入要验证的服务器的IP地址或域名。
    3. 选择扫描方式:常用的扫描方式有三种,分别是TCP连接扫描、SYN扫描和UDP扫描。其中TCP连接扫描是最常用的方式,它通过尝试建立与目标端口的TCP连接,如果连接成功则说明端口是开放的;SYN扫描则是发送一个SYN包给目标端口,如果返回SYN/ACK包则说明端口是开放的;UDP扫描则是发送一个UDP包给目标端口,如果收到响应则说明端口是开放的。
    4. 设置扫描参数:可以设置扫描的端口范围和超时时间等参数。
    5. 开始扫描:点击开始扫描按钮,等待扫描结果。
    6. 分析扫描结果:根据扫描结果分析服务器上的端口开放情况,并根据需要采取相应的安全措施。

    服务器端口验证的目的是确保服务器上的端口只开放必需的服务,并及时发现并修补可能存在的安全漏洞。通过定期进行端口验证,可以提高服务器的安全性,减少被攻击的风险。同时,也可以帮助系统管理员更好地了解服务器上的网络配置,并及时发现和解决网络问题。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部